The Importance Of Core Temperature Monitoring For Optimal Health

core temperature monitoring is a crucial aspect of maintaining good health and preventing serious medical conditions. The body’s core temperature refers to the internal temperature of the body, which is regulated by the hypothalamus in the brain. Normal core body temperature typically ranges between 97.8°F to 99.1°F, but it can fluctuate due to various factors such as physical activity, environmental conditions, and illness.

Monitoring core temperature is essential for ensuring that the body functions properly and efficiently. When the core temperature deviates from the normal range, it can indicate underlying health issues that need to be addressed promptly. Here are some key reasons why core temperature monitoring is important for optimal health:

1. Detection of Fever: One of the primary reasons for monitoring core temperature is to detect fever, which is a common symptom of infections and other illnesses. Fever is the body’s natural response to fighting off pathogens, but prolonged high fever can cause serious complications. By monitoring core temperature, individuals can identify fever early on and seek appropriate medical treatment.

2. Monitoring Exercise Intensity: Athletes and fitness enthusiasts often use core temperature monitoring to assess their workout intensity and performance. Elevated core temperature during exercise can be a sign of exertion and dehydration, which can lead to heat-related illnesses. By tracking core temperature, athletes can adjust their workout intensity and hydration levels to prevent overheating and improve their overall performance.

3. Managing Heat Stress: Exposure to hot and humid environments can lead to heat stress, a condition where the body’s core temperature rises above normal levels. Heat stress can result in heat exhaustion or even heat stroke if not addressed promptly. core temperature monitoring is crucial for identifying signs of heat stress and taking appropriate measures to cool down the body and prevent heat-related illnesses.

4. Monitoring Hypothermia: On the other end of the spectrum, low core body temperature can indicate hypothermia, a condition where the body loses heat faster than it can produce it. Hypothermia can be life-threatening if not treated promptly. core temperature monitoring is essential for detecting signs of hypothermia and initiating appropriate warming measures to prevent further complications.

5. Monitoring Menstrual Cycle: Core temperature monitoring can also be used to track changes in basal body temperature throughout the menstrual cycle. Women can use this information to identify ovulation and fertile days, which can be helpful for family planning or conception. Monitoring core temperature can provide valuable insights into the body’s hormonal fluctuations and reproductive health.

6. Monitoring Sleep Quality: Core temperature plays a crucial role in regulating the body’s circadian rhythm and sleep-wake cycle. Monitoring core temperature during sleep can help individuals assess the quality of their sleep and identify any disruptions or abnormalities. Maintaining a stable core body temperature is essential for achieving restful and rejuvenating sleep.

7. Preventing Sudden Infant Death Syndrome (SIDS): Core temperature monitoring is particularly important for infants, as they have difficulties regulating their body temperature. Sudden Infant Death Syndrome (SIDS) is a serious concern for newborns, and monitoring their core temperature during sleep can help reduce the risk of SIDS. Keeping infants at a comfortable and safe temperature is crucial for their overall health and well-being.
